Counting scales are used to count money and other items in food, retail, and hospitality industries. These scales are able to tell the amount of money based on the weight, as they are pre-programmed to tell how much various bills and coins weigh individually. Counting scales often contain a memory component that stores the number and weight of various manufacturing parts. Many models simultaneously show the piece count, unit piece weight and the weight readout of the items on the scale.
Counting scales are a very convenient piece of equipment because they save time without sacrificing accuracy. They also require no labor cost. Counting scales are efficient and eliminate the human error associated with counting by hand. They also tend to be very durable, portable, easy to use, and space-efficient. Counting scales are available in many sizes, constructions, and features.
